The Holy Grail Of PNG Optimization: Compressing Without Quality Loss

You need 4 min read Post on Mar 16, 2025
The Holy Grail Of PNG Optimization: Compressing Without Quality Loss
The Holy Grail Of PNG Optimization: Compressing Without Quality Loss
Article with TOC

Table of Contents

The Holy Grail of PNG Optimization: Compressing Without Quality Loss

The quest for the perfect PNG optimization technique is a constant struggle for web developers and designers. We all want smaller file sizes to improve website loading speeds, but nobody wants to sacrifice image quality. This article delves into the holy grail of PNG optimization: achieving significant compression without compromising the crispness, clarity, and detail that make PNGs so valuable.

What Makes PNG Optimization So Important?

Before diving into the techniques, let's understand why PNG optimization is crucial. PNGs, with their lossless compression, are ideal for images with sharp lines, text, and logos – elements where even minor artifacts are unacceptable. However, their file size can be significantly larger than other formats like JPEG. Larger file sizes directly impact:

  • Website Loading Speed: Slower loading times lead to higher bounce rates and negatively impact user experience (UX). Search engines also penalize slow-loading websites.
  • Bandwidth Consumption: Large images consume more bandwidth, increasing hosting costs and potentially frustrating users with slow connections.
  • Overall Performance: Optimized PNGs contribute to a smoother, more responsive website, enhancing the overall user experience.

Understanding PNG Compression Methods

PNG compression relies on a lossless algorithm, meaning no information is lost during the compression process. Unlike JPEG, which uses lossy compression (discarding some data to reduce size), PNG retains all image data. This is why finding the sweet spot between compression and quality is so critical.

Several techniques can significantly reduce PNG file sizes without impacting visual quality:

1. Choosing the Right PNG Format: 8-bit vs. 24-bit vs. 32-bit

Understanding the differences between these formats is paramount.

  • 8-bit PNG: Uses a limited color palette (up to 256 colors). Ideal for simple images with flat colors or icons. Offers excellent compression ratios.
  • 24-bit PNG: Supports a full range of colors (16.7 million). Best for images with rich color gradients and photorealistic elements. Compression is still good but less aggressive than 8-bit.
  • 32-bit PNG: Adds an alpha channel for transparency, making it suitable for images with semi-transparent areas. Compression is similar to 24-bit.

Choosing the appropriate format based on your image's complexity significantly impacts file size. Avoid using a 24-bit PNG for an image that only needs 8 bits – it's wasteful!

2. Utilizing PNG Optimization Tools

Many online and offline tools are designed to optimize PNGs without sacrificing quality. These tools employ advanced compression algorithms and techniques that often go beyond simple compression software. Popular options include:

  • Online Optimizers: TinyPNG, ImageOptim, and Kraken.io are popular choices offering free tiers and often sophisticated compression techniques.
  • Offline Optimizers: Software like PNGOUT, OptiPNG, and ImageAlpha provide more control and can be integrated into workflows.

These tools often employ techniques like filtering and adaptive quantization to minimize file size without visible artifacts.

3. Reducing Image Dimensions and Resolution

Before even thinking about compression, consider the actual size and resolution of your image. If the image is larger than necessary (e.g., a 2000px wide image displayed at 500px), you're wasting bandwidth. Resize images to their actual display dimensions using appropriate image editing software before optimizing. Choosing the correct resolution also plays a critical role. Consider the DPI (dots per inch) necessary for your image; a higher DPI means a larger file size.

How to Choose the Best Optimization Method

The best optimization method depends on your specific needs and the nature of your images. Experimentation is key! Try different tools and compare the results visually. Use a tool that shows a preview before compression to ensure no visible quality loss.

Remember to always back up your original images before any optimization process.

Frequently Asked Questions

What is the difference between lossy and lossless compression?

Lossy compression (like JPEG) discards some image data to reduce file size, resulting in some quality loss. Lossless compression (like PNG) retains all image data, ensuring no quality loss.

Can I compress a PNG without losing quality?

Yes, you can compress a PNG significantly without visible quality loss using advanced optimization techniques and the right tools.

Which PNG optimization tool is the best?

The "best" tool depends on your needs and workflow. TinyPNG, Kraken.io, and ImageOptim are popular online options, while PNGOUT and OptiPNG are powerful command-line tools.

How do I choose the right PNG bit depth?

Use 8-bit PNGs for images with simple colors and icons. Use 24-bit for images with rich colors, and 32-bit when transparency is required.

What if I lose some quality after compression?

If you notice quality loss, try different optimization tools or adjust their settings. You might need to accept a slightly larger file size to maintain the desired quality.

By understanding the nuances of PNG compression and leveraging the available tools, you can achieve the holy grail of PNG optimization – significantly smaller file sizes without compromising the visual quality your website deserves. Remember that the key is a balance between compression and acceptable quality – finding the perfect sweet spot for your specific images.

The Holy Grail Of PNG Optimization: Compressing Without Quality Loss
The Holy Grail Of PNG Optimization: Compressing Without Quality Loss

Thank you for visiting our website wich cover about The Holy Grail Of PNG Optimization: Compressing Without Quality Loss. We hope the information provided has been useful to you. Feel free to contact us if you have any questions or need further assistance. See you next time and dont miss to bookmark.
close
close